Security model and threat profile

Trezor Suite is intentionally built around a threat model where the host (your computer) may be compromised. The security assumptions are clear:

  • Private keys never leave the device: Seeds and private keys are generated and stored in the secure element of the hardware wallet and do not get exported to the host.
  • Transaction signing on-device: Users verify and confirm transactions through the Trezor device screen, which prevents a compromised host from silently changing transaction parameters.
  • Open-source firmware and client: Trezor provides transparency—anyone can audit the code which reduces the chance of hidden backdoors.

Even with those protections, users should be aware of other attack vectors: phishing sites impersonating Suite interfaces, supply-chain attacks when buying hardware from unofficial resellers, and social engineering around seed backups. The Suite addresses these through firmware verification, firmware updates, and UX prompts that emphasize verification steps.

Secure setup & backup

Getting a secure initial setup is a decisive step toward long-term safety. These are the recommended steps when initializing Trezor and the Suite:

  • Buy from official channels: Purchase Trezor devices from the manufacturer or verified resellers to reduce tampering risk.
  • Verify firmware: On first connection, allow the device to verify its firmware via the Suite and update to the latest signed firmware before use.
  • Create seed offline: Generate a fresh recovery seed using the device’s screen and write it down on the provided recovery card—never store a seed on a digital device or cloud storage.
  • Use a passphrase: Optionally add a passphrase (also called a 25th word) to create hidden wallets and add plausible deniability—but treat the passphrase like an additional key you must protect.
  • Test recovery: Perform a test restore on a second device (or a reputable emulator) to ensure your seed and backup procedures work as intended.

Backup checklist

  1. Seed physically written on multiple secure copies.
  2. One copy stored off-site (safe deposit box or equivalent).
  3. Passphrase documented securely if used.
  4. Emergency instruction for heirs or trusted parties (without revealing the seed itself).

Everyday best practices

Using Trezor Suite well means combining good digital hygiene with operational practices that limit exposure. Here are pragmatic rules of thumb that cover daily and periodic activities:

  • Keep the device offline when not actively transacting: Connect only to build and sign transactions, then disconnect.
  • Always verify addresses on-device: When sending funds, use the Suite’s address preview and check the address on the Trezor screen to be sure it hasn’t been altered by malware.
  • Update Suite and firmware promptly: Modern wallets patch bugs and address vulnerabilities. Updates are part of maintaining a secure posture.
  • Use separate accounts for different purposes: Separate high-value long-term holdings from frequent trading wallets to reduce blast radius if a mistake occurs.
  • Limit third-party integrations: Use built-in exchange or integration services only after verifying reputations and reviewing required permissions.

Advanced usage and integrations

Power users will appreciate Trezor Suite’s ability to integrate with other tools while keeping keys secure. Advanced patterns include:

  • Multisig setups: Combine Trezor with other hardware or software signers to require multiple approvals for high-value transactions.
  • Custom firmware and advanced coin support: For niche chains, evaluate community-supported tools but prioritize audited integrations.
  • Encrypted backups and secret sharing: Use Shamir’s Secret Sharing or professional custodial services if you need redundancy above a simple seed backup.
  • Auditable workflows: Maintain an immutable (offline) record of signing policies and authorized signers for corporate or fiduciary environments.

How Trezor Suite compares to other wallet approaches

There are several classes of wallet solutions: custodial exchanges, hot software wallets, mobile wallets, and hardware wallets plus suite applications. Trezor Suite sits firmly in the cold storage category while offering a modern management experience. Compared to custodial solutions, Suite gives full key ownership and control. Versus hot wallets, it greatly reduces the risk of key compromise at the cost of slightly more friction for signing transactions. For users who prioritize sovereignty and security, Suite strikes a well-balanced tradeoff.

Is Trezor Suite difficult to learn?

New users can follow guided flows to set up a device securely. The learning curve exists primarily around backup discipline and the mental model of signing transactions offline. Once you’ve completed a few transactions, the process becomes intuitive.

What should I do if I lose my Trezor?

If you lose the device but have your seed, you can restore the wallet to a new Trezor or compatible wallet. If the seed is compromised, move funds immediately using a new seed and device.
